Sleep is very important for our physical and mental health. Do you suffer from any medical illness that is affecting your sleep like any pain, any problems with breathing, any problems with heart? Some medications which you take for physical health issues may affect your sleep or you on any medications? Do have any h/o of mental health problems? Do you misuse drugs or alcohol? Is falling asleep is a problem? Is your sleep broken ? Are you waking up early in morning? If you can point out which of the above fits your sleep problem then we treat accordingly Depression, anxiety are one of the common causes for sleep disturbance.

Sleep problem is a symptom and is secondary to a problem in majority of cases. Hence it is important to know the reason for having sleep issue. It could be due to life style  issues, stress, anxiety , depression , chronic pain, that way a lot of causes. It is important to get a consultation to understand the problem in detail. Simply taking sleep tablets is not advisable as you can become addicted to those and in long term that itself will become a problem
